This paper aims to prove a Hörmander multiplier theorem for sub-Laplacians on nilpotent Lie groups. We investigate the holomorphic functional calculus of the sub-Laplacians, then we link the \(L^1\) norm of the complex time heat kernels with the order of differentiability needed in the Hörmander multiplier theorem. As applications, we show that order \(d/2+1\) suffices for homogeneous nilpotent groups of homogeneous dimension \(d\), while for generalized Heisenberg groups with underlying space \(\mathbb{R}^{2n+k}\) and homogeneous dimension \(2n+ 2k\), we show that order \(n+ (k+ 5)/2\) for \(k\) odd and \(n+ 3+ k/2\) for \(k\) even is enough; this is strictly less than half of the homogeneous dimension when \(k\) is sufficiently large.
